Handsfree Cooking Web Component
A drop-in Web Component that adds voice-controlled recipe navigation to any website using the browser's Web Speech API. No framework required.

Web Speech API and customElements are browser-only APIs — they don't exist in the Node.js server environment. You must lazy-load the component on the client side.

Attributes
| Attribute | Default | Description |
|---|---|---|
| lang | Page lang attribute or en | BCP-47 language code for speech recognition (e.g. en, da, ar) |
| steps-selector | .recipe-step | CSS selector matching each recipe step element |
| ingredients-selector | #ingredients | CSS selector for the ingredients section heading/container |
| instructions-selector | #instructions | CSS selector for the instructions section heading/container |
| button-skin-url | (built-in skin image) | Optional background image URL for buttons using the hf-button--skin class |
| translations | (built-in English) | JSON string to override any UI text (see below) |
| commands | (built-in English) | JSON string to override voice command aliases (see below) |
Voice Commands
Built-in defaults (English)
| Action | Accepted phrases | |---|---| | Go to next step | "next step", "go forward", "next" | | Go to previous step | "previous step", "go back", "previous" | | Scroll up | "scroll up" | | Scroll down | "scroll down" | | Go to ingredients | "go to ingredients", "ingredients" | | Go to instructions | "go to instructions", "go to method", "instructions" | | Show help | "help", "commands" | | Start cooking | "let's cook", "lets cook", "start cooking" | | Finish | "i'm done", "im done", "done", "finish" | | Exit help | "exit", "close" |
How command matching works
When the user speaks, the component:
- Normalizes the transcript (lowercase, strip punctuation, normalize Unicode/Arabic diacritics)
- Compares it against every registered alias using a scoring system:
- Exact match = score 3 (highest)
- Starts with or ends with an alias = score 2
- Contains the alias as a whole word = score 1
- Picks the best-scoring match (ties broken by longest alias)
This means users don't need to say the exact phrase — "go to the next step please" still matches "next step".
Customizing commands (other languages / extra aliases)
Pass a commands attribute with a JSON string. Each key maps to an array of accepted phrases:
<handsfree-cooking
lang="da"
commands='{
"nextStep": ["næste trin", "gå videre"],
"previousStep": ["forrige trin", "gå tilbage"],
"scrollUp": ["rul op"],
"scrollDown": ["rul ned"],
"goToIngredients": ["gå til ingredienser"],
"goToInstructions": ["gå til fremgangsmåde"],
"help": ["hjælp"],
"letsCook": ["lad os lave mad"],
"imDone": ["jeg er færdig"],
"exit": ["luk"]
}'
></handsfree-cooking>Available command keys:
| Key | What it does |
|---|---|
| nextStep | Scrolls to the next step element |
| previousStep | Scrolls to the previous step element |
| scrollUp | Scrolls the page up by 300px |
| scrollDown | Scrolls the page down by 300px |
| goToIngredients | Scrolls to the ingredients section |
| goToInstructions | Scrolls to the instructions section |
| help | Opens the help overlay listing all commands |
| letsCook | Starts the active listening phase (from introduction) |
| imDone | Triggers the finish/feedback screen |
| exit | Closes the help overlay |

}Events
The component dispatches CustomEvents that bubble through the DOM. Listen on document or on the element itself:
| Event | detail | When |
|---|---|---|
| handsfree-activated | — | User clicks the "Handsfree cooking" button |
| handsfree-command | { command } | A voice command is recognized and executed |
| handsfree-error | { error } | Mic blocked, browser not supported, etc. |
| handsfree-state-change | { stage, isListening } | Stage or listening state changes |
| handsfree-finished | { reason } | User finishes or stops cooking |
| handsfree-feedback | { vote, text } | User taps thumbs up/down or closes. vote is "up", "down", or "close". text is the translated label. |

})Styling
The component uses Shadow DOM, so its styles are fully encapsulated. Override the look using CSS custom properties on the <handsfree-cooking> element or any ancestor:

></handsfree-cooking>User Flow
- User sees the "Handsfree cooking" button on the recipe page
- Clicking it opens the introduction popup explaining the feature
- The component requests microphone access via the browser
- Once allowed, the user navigates the introduction steps, then says "Let's cook" (or taps the arrow)
- The component enters listening mode — a floating widget shows "Ready for instructions"
- The user speaks commands like "next step", "go to ingredients", "scroll down"
- When the last step is reached, the widget prompts "Say 'I'm done'"
- After finishing, a feedback screen lets the user vote thumbs up/down
- The widget closes

Browser Support
| Browser | Supported | |---|---| | Google Chrome (desktop & Android) | Yes | | Safari (desktop & iOS) | Yes | | Microsoft Edge | Yes | | Firefox | No (Web Speech API not available) |
